Tahitian | Madurese | |
---|---|---|
Family | Austronesian, Malayo-Polynesian | Austronesian, Malayo-Polynesian |
Speakers | Approximately 120,000 | Approximately 13.5 million |
Features | A Polynesian language with simple grammar and a rich oral tradition; noted for its lack of consonant clusters and reliance on vowel sounds | A language with distinct phonetic features, such as a reduced vowel inventory and a preference for glottal stops; it exhibits a high degree of mutual unintelligibility with Javanese despite geographic proximity. |
Countries | French Polynesia (primarily Tahiti) | Indonesia (primarily on Madura Island and in parts of East Java, including Surabaya and surrounding areas) |
Writing System | Latin script | Latin script (modern use), previously Javanese and Pegon scripts (Arabic-derived script) |
Tonal | No | No |
Grammatical Cases | No, uses prepositions to indicate grammatical relationships | No, uses prepositions and affixes to mark relationships |
Derived From | Proto-Polynesian, closely related to Hawaiian and Māori | Proto-Malayo-Polynesian |
Loanwords | From French and other Polynesian languages | From Javanese, Sanskrit, Arabic, and Dutch |
Dialects | Includes regional variations within French Polynesia, though generally uniform across the islands | Includes Bangkalan, Sumenep, and Pamekasan dialects, with significant lexical and phonological differences |
Alphabets | A, E, F, H, I, M, N, O, P, R, T, U, V | A, B, C, D, E, G, H, I, J, K, L, M, N, O, P, R, S, T, U, W, Y, Z |
